1f1ajgWhen the verdict is guilty, the individual facing a prison sentence has his world collapse in front of him. On the side, his wife and children are thrust along into this tumultuous avalanche.

R-U- IN?

To ease the pain

Dror’s organization tries to remove some of the shackles of the RUIN of prison life by assisting indicted and imprisoned Jews and their families face the adversity and challenge by offering support, legal counsel, therapy, kosher meals, women’s retreats, family weekend getaways, support groups for wives of imprisoned spouses, children’s outings, and transportation to visit loved ones in prison, delinquency prevention seminars and more.

To describe the impact Dror has, can only be adequately portrayed by its grateful recipients’. As one inmate poignantly penned his appreciation: “I am writing to thank you and your donors for providing such wonderful kosher meals for us in the visiting room at Ft. Dix West. I had brisket and kasha and even a black and white cookie! I regret that I was unable to eat such food yesterday for Shabbos or on Tuesday for Rosh Chodesh, but it’s such a special treat for me and my visitors. As you know, the visiting room provides temporary Pidyon Shvuyim from the trials and tribulations and your efforts make the visits even nicer.”

Following a weekend retreat for families of inmates, a friend of the family sent this email t o Dror: “You should just know about the Shabbos… Mrs. F. and her family weren’t so happy about going, and Friday afternoon already on the bus she was all nervous… And later she called me almost in tears about how this is so not their thing and crowd, and she has no company etc…. And I did all I can to beg her to give it a chance – Friday afternoon is hardly a time to gather an impression! The next time I heard from her – Motzei Shabbos – it was a totally different person! She went on and on for days how amazing it was, and how everyone was taken care of, and everyone felt comfortable… It was really a life saver for everyone in the family – emotionally as well as physically….”

And from Mrs.Leah Rabushkin: “Words cannot really thank you for the amazing Shabbos that we just spent all together . You cannot imagine the impact that it makes on the families just to be with people that understand you, know where you’re coming from. Throughout the Shabbaton different people came over to me and we spoke, shared and just discussed different issues that go on in our lives . The kids felt so treated, the gashmios was unbelievable, the speakers were so inspiring and the atmosphere was incredible. Oh, and the entertainment was just so hysterical, my husband laughed so hard as I tried to give over the lines I remembered…”
